Summary
SR0941 is a Senate Resolution memorializing Dennis M. Laird, a resident of Moline, Illinois, who passed away on April 16, 2024. The resolution expresses the sorrow of the members of the Illinois Senate upon learning of Laird's death and acknowledges his contributions to his community and country. Laird was born on August 17, 1949, and served in the U.S. Army with the 23 Infantry Division during the Vietnam War. He is remembered for his commitment to service and his deep ties to the Quad Cities community.
